Access to the project site is <br /> proposed from Kawili Street and Laukapu Street, both County roadways. Tentatively, an <br /> ingress-only access from Kawili Street is being proposed, while the Laukapu Street end <br /> would be a frill movement access. However, the applicant would like to retain the option <br /> of full movement accesses from both Laukapu and Kawili Streets. There are no <br /> sidewalks in the area. According to the Department of Public Works, Kawili Street is a <br /> secondary arterial with a right-of-way width of 80 feet. DPW recommends no or limited <br /> access to/from Kawili Street. Laukapu Street is a collector with a right-of-way of 40 feet <br /> fronting the property. Although the City of Hilo Zone Map does not show a future road <br /> widening setback for Laukapu Street, the applicant/landowner of the property across <br /> Laukapu Street to the west (TMK: 2-2-50: 37 and 38) was required to provide a 10-foot <br /> future road widening strip when the property was rezoned in 2003. Therefore, to be <br /> consistent with the condition of approval for TMK: 2-2-50: 37 and 38, a condition will be <br /> included to provide a 10-foot future road widening strip along the eastern side of Laukapu <br /> Street fronting the subject property. A condition of approval will also require that the <br /> applicant install concrete curb, gutter and sidewalk along the Laukapu Street property <br /> frontage, as well as pavement widening, drainage improvements, and utility relocation <br /> that may be required by the Department of Public Works. These improvements will be <br /> located within the road widening strip which will be delineated and dedicated to the <br /> County if required by the Department of Public Works. <br /> <br /> County water is available to the site. The project will connect to the County's <br /> sewer line. Solid waste will be handled by commercial haulers. If required, a Solid <br /> Waste Management Plan will be prepared. Electricity and telephone services are <br /> available to the site. <br /> <br /> The property has no severe geological or topographical problems which cannot be <br /> rectified or which would render the land unusable. The project site is located within Zone <br /> "X", area detennined to be outside the 500-year floodplain. All development generated <br /> storm run-off shall be disposed of on-site and not allowed onto adjacent properties or <br /> roadways. <br />
